What does the failure to meet interchange criteria cause in transaction processing?

Explanation:
The failure to meet interchange criteria results in a downgrade of the transaction. Interchange criteria are specific requirements set by payment networks that determine the eligibility of a transaction for the optimal interchange rate. When a transaction does not meet these criteria, it may be classified as a higher-risk or less desirable type of transaction. Consequently, it is subject to a higher fee structure, leading to a downgrade. This downgrade process typically means that the transaction will incur additional fees, which can affect the overall cost for the merchant. It is essential for merchants and payment processors to be aware of these criteria to maximize their transaction approvals at the best possible rates. This not only streamlines transaction processing but also helps in managing overall operational costs.
